Our Mission
The 180 Society is a New Jersey based addiction and recovery support group, rooted in community, compassion, holistic healing, and integrated plant-based practices.
Our goal is to establish a trusted network of safe, stigma-free, cannabis friendly meeting rooms across New Jersey — spaces that provide connection, support, and a sense of belonging for those working to heal, grow, and turn their lives around.
Whether you are struggling with addiction, sober-curious, having trouble relating to traditional support groups, seeking a plant-friendly alternative, or simply exploring new ways to live with clarity and balance, you are welcome here exactly as you are.
Life can take us down difficult roads at times. Trauma, isolation, life changes, stress, and substance abuse can leave us feeling stuck, afraid, and alone. But the moment you choose to shift direction—even slightly — a new path becomes possible.
At The 180 Society, we meet you in that moment with understanding ... not judgment, and with community ... not isolation. Together, we support one another in turning away from what no longer serves us, and moving toward a life grounded in clarity, connection, and purpose.
At our core, we believe that connection—to self, to others, and to something greater than our current circumstances—is a powerful catalyst for change. For some, that connection may be spiritual or rooted in faith. For others, it may come through community, science, nature, personal reflection, or lived experience. We do not define that for you. The 180 Society is inclusive of all belief systems, and no specific spiritual framework is required to participate. What matters is openness, honesty, and a willingness to grow and change.
With over eight billion people roaming on the planet, we firmly believe that no two paths are the same; healing must honor the unique journey of every individual.

Who Is The 180 Society For?
At The 180 Society, we are crystal clear about our purpose -- This is not about getting high and this is not a smokers club! This is about healing, addressing trauma, and turning away from destructive patterns and toward a life of stability and purpose. The 180 has been established for those who:
-
Want to leave alcohol or hard drugs behind
-
Are sober-curious and questioning their relationship with substances
-
Are in early recovery (“Cali-Sober”) and looking for additional support
-
Tried traditional groups and did not feel it resonated
-
Are isolated, alone, and stuck.
-
Those entering or exiting licensed treatment facilities and programs
-
Believe cannabis can be integrated responsibly into recovery
-
Value harm reduction and education
-
Want accountability without shame
-
Want community without dogmare
-
Are serious about changing their lives
